Unforgettable






















A Night to Remember!
The music of some of the biggest artists from the 1950’s and 1960’s will come to life with a brand new show, Unforgettable at Chelmsford Civic Theatre on Sunday 1 April, providing a night of world class
entertainment and nostalgia that you will never forget!
‘Unforgettable’ is a first class production that highlights the musical icons of this era – favourite musical legends such as Elvis Presley, Nat King Cole, Buddy Holly, The Everly Brothers, Frankie Valley, Aretha Franklin, Dionne Warwick, The Beach Boys, The Carpenters, The Beatles and many more .
With four superb leading artists delivering first class vocals and harmonies, the first set features the post war, early rock n roll music of the 1950’s providing an authentic feel to the glamour era of the period moving on in the second set to include the high energy and much loved pop sounds of the 60’s.
The international cast includes superb lead vocalists Diana Nash and Neil Couperthwaite from the UK, Patrick Maubert from Canada and Kellie Schreiber from the United States. The show is backed by world class musicians.
Diana Nash says: “I am really looking forward to being a part of this fantastic new production. I love the music of this era and the show features many of my favourite artists - people like Nat King Cole. We are in rehearsals at the moment and the whole cast are very excited about the launch of the show. This show is really upbeat with wall to wall music so it’s going to be a great show to be part of!”
The fast moving, high impact show is packed with back to back hits and medleys featuring popular tracks taking you right back on a journey of complete nostalgia - from high tempo favourites such as ‘Tutti Frutti’ and ‘Shake Rattle & Roll’ through to popular ballads such as ‘A House Is Not A Home’ and ‘Crazy’.
Other songs include ‘Downtown’, ‘Fever’ ‘My Guy, ‘Dream Dream’, ‘Bye Bye Love’, ‘Say A Little Prayer’, ‘Under the Moon of Love’, ‘Close To You’, ‘Move Over Darling’ and many, many more.
